What is a multi-rotor platforms UAV drone?

  • Multi rotor unmanned aerial vehicles rely on multiple propellers working together to generate lift, without the need for taxiing and takeoff like airplanes or complex mechanical variable pitch structures like helicopters. ‌‌‌
  • Structural composition: It mainly consists of a frame, motor, propeller, battery, and flight control system. Common layouts include four axis, six axis, eight axis, etc. The number of rotors is usually even to ensure torque balance.
  • Flight principle: By changing the speed of each motor to adjust lift and torque, it can achieve ascent, descent, forward, backward, left, right movement, and rotation. Some advanced aircraft models support blade breakage protection, allowing for safe return even if individual motors fail.
  • Technical parameters: The common wheelbase is between 1000 millimeters and 2000 millimeters, the no-load endurance time is usually 30 to 60 minutes, the maximum wind resistance can reach level 7, and some industrial grade models can carry a load of over 40 kilograms.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of multi-rotor platform UAVs?

The reason why multi rotor drones are popular is that they are very useful in specific scenarios, but there are also obvious physical limitations. ‌‌‌

Main advantages:

  • Easy to operate: With simple training, you can get started, and the flight control system can automatically maintain stable posture.
  • Strong environmental adaptability: capable of vertical takeoff and landing in complex terrains such as cities and mountainous areas, without the need for specialized runways.
  • Good hovering performance: It can stay at a certain point in the air for a long time, which is very suitable for shooting or fine inspection. ‌‌‌

Main disadvantages:

  • Shorter endurance: Most battery powered multi rotor drones have a flight time of less than 1 hour, which is not as long-lasting as fixed wing drones.
  • Speed limited: Cruise speed is usually between 10 and 23 meters per second, which is not suitable for long-distance fast transportation.
  • Weak wind resistance: When encountering strong winds of 5-6 levels or above, flight stability will decrease and there is a risk of flight restrictions.

What is the difference between fixed wing drones and unmanned aerial vehicles?

Many people easily confuse multi rotor and fixed wing, but in fact, they are like the difference between “helicopter” and “airplane”, with completely different applicable scenarios. ‌‌‌

  • Takeoff and landing methods: Multi rotor aircraft can take off and land vertically in place, while fixed wing aircraft require runway or catapult takeoff and cannot hover in the air.
  • Flight efficiency: The fixed wing relies on the wing to generate lift, and the range can reach several hours or even longer, suitable for large-scale mapping; Multi rotor relies on electric motors to resist gravity, consumes power quickly, and is suitable for small-scale operations.
  • Application focus: Multi rotor is commonly used for aerial photography, short distance inspections, and indoor operations; Fixed wings are more commonly used for long endurance missions such as land surveys and border patrols. ‌‌‌
